South African speedster Kagiso Rabada served a one-month ban, reduced from three months, for using a recreational drug during the SA20, held earlier this year, according to ESPNcricinfo.
South Africa and Gujarat Titans speedster Kagiso Rabada's departure from the ongoing 18th edition of the Indian Premier League on April 3 was related to a sanction for testing positive for a "recreational drug".
